I put new seals in the gs650 forks I bought for my bike. I followed the instructions on here to set the fluid level (compressed fork w/ no spring, set up a "sucker" at the correct depth, poured some fluid in and pumped them, pour in more fluid and pump them, keep filling and pumping until it is near where it has to be then suck out to correct level). Here's the problem.. while I was filling and pumping I noticed that the only real resistance is at the very top and very bottom of the stroke. Does that mean there is still air in there? Should I worry about it? Is my fluid level wrong? I left the forks sit for a half hour compressed with the fluid level about 4" from the top in hopes any air would work out. I also pumped them for about 15 min straight and no change. They are air forks, so would air pressure change anything? I am worried they might not be working correctly. Any ideas?
Thanks
Nate
 
What fluid did you use? Heavier fork oils will provide more resistance, but it is not unusual to have more resistance toward the end of travel. This helps prevent topping or bottoming.

The fact that they are air forks only means that air is added as an additional spring, and does not really mean anything in regards to damping.

.
 
I used Bel-Ray 15w fork oil. It seems like there is almost no resistance in the middle. Granted I wasn't pumping it fast, but I still think there should be some drag as I'm pulling it through it's stroke.
 
I used Bel-Ray 15w fork oil. It seems like there is almost no resistance in the middle. Granted I wasn't pumping it fast, but I still think there should be some drag as I'm pulling it through it's stroke.

Nah, sounds OK. At the speeds you are moving it, there will be almost no resistance. Make sure you worked the air out, which it sounds like you did OK, set the level and button them up. Damper rod forks don't have a lot of places to trap air like the current generation of twin chamber MX forks (now those are a PITA to pull apart and rebuild), just stroking them a few times should be more than enough.

Do NOT add more fork oil.

Never go above the 140mm level (measured with springs out and forks collapsed all the way) or you run the risk of hydro-locking when the forks compress all the way.
 
If you can bottom the forks the springs are sacked out. replace them with progressively wound units.
Spacers only mask the problem. You will still bottom out, only sooner. The springs will be compressed more than the damper rod.

Then you can experiment with the oil as to how it reacts . Oil is for dampening (controlling) the movements, the spring actually supports the bike.

Your forks sound different to mine. I have attached a picture of them. Mine has the main spring, close wound to the top, a spring cup, a spacer 77mm, then the top nut cap. The top nut cap touches the spacer when it is partially screwed in. Inside the inner tube there is a damper with a bush and a short spring.
 
Last edited:
That fork looks identical to mine, even the top cap. So in your forks there is no "short" spring on the top, just a solid spacer? When I look at the fiche for an 81 650g there is a short spring but for an 81 850g there is just a spacer. Maybe just a spacer is the cure to my problems.
 
That fork looks identical to mine, even the top cap. So in your forks there is no "short" spring on the top, just a solid spacer? When I look at the fiche for an 81 650g there is a short spring but for an 81 850g there is just a spacer. Maybe just a spacer is the cure to my problems.

Definitely only the spacer on top for the GS1000G and GS850G. The spring is 421 mm long and must not be shorter than 416 mm according to the manual. Someone must have done some modification to yours that did not work. The spacer is just a rolled bit of flat metal and you can easily make them up if you cannot get any I think.
